Section 27
Repeal
27. Repeal :
The following Nepal laws have been repealed :-
(a) The Arms or Ammunition Act brought into force according to the Khadga Nisana (the then law) which received assest on Vickram Era 1965 Monday, Falgun 25 and the amendments made from time to time.
(b) No. 99 of Amini Jawata,
(c) Section 4 of the Madesh Goshwara Act, 2022 (1965)
(d) Section 58 of Amini Sawal,
(e) The words “the I.G.P. shall issue licence to let import the arms or ammunition from abroad and to the person who buys them within the country including the function of issuing permit for hunting and also the
function of issuing permit to keep the arms in the house” of the heading of Section 4 of the Kathmandu Valley Commissioner Magistrate Sawal and Clause (a) and Clause (b),
(f) Sections 109 and 111 of the Central Police Goshwara Sawal,
(g) Section 61 of the Madesh Police Inspector Sawal,
(h) The order made in the name of Ne.Pu.Da. Ja of 2002/11/4 (Feb. 15, 1945),
(i) The additional sawal of 2003/12/13 in the name of Inspector according to acceptance of the report of 2003/11/7 (Feb. 18, 1946),
(j) All other sawal sanad in relation to the arms or ammunition.
Note:- 1. The words transformed by the Local Administration Act, 2022 (1965) :-
“Instead of “Bada Hakim” or “Magistrate” the word “Commissioner”
2. The words transformed by the Police (First Amendment) Act, 2029 (1972) :-
Instead of “Assistant Sub-Inspector” the words “Sahayek Nirikshayaka”.
3. The words transformed by the Nepal Law (Amendment) Act, 2024 (1967) :-
(a) “Prahari” for “Police”
(b) “Adhikrit” for “Officer”
(c) “Rajpatra” for “Gazette”
(d) “Pratibedan” for “Report”
(e) “Punarabedan” for ” Appeal”
4. The words transformed by the Arms or Ammunition (First Amendment) Act,
2048 (1991) :-
“Chief District Officer” for “Local Commissioner” or “Commissioner”.
5. The words “His Majesty’s Government of Nepal” has been substituted by “Government of Nepal” by Some Nepal Laws Amendment Act, 2063.
